这种方式属于前后端不分离的架构,在现在前后端分离盛行的今天,可能就已经不是很合适了。本文这里使用Flask+Vue前后端分离的方式,去搭建一个后台管理系统。 什么是前后端分离 前后端分离是一种新的开发模式,当然称其为新的架构模式也不为过。说得通俗一点就是,我们在后端的项目里面看不到HTML页面。在开发过程中,...
进入vue-web项目 /myproject$ cd vue-web/ # 3. 安装依赖 /myproject/vue-web$ sudo npm install # 4. 打包Vue项目,之后得到一个dist文件夹。 /myproject/vue-web$ sudo npm run build:mock (#这里暂时用mock数据build) # 以下是开发时,启动项目... # 本地开发 启动项目 /myproject/vue-web$ sudo...
然后cd到client目录,安装element-plus/icons-vue# npm install @element-plus/icons-vue 然后cd到client目录,安装axios(前后端分离的应用,要安装请求的库axios)# npm install --save axios 前端代码(myvue\client\scr\components\DataQuery.vue) <template> <el-form :inline="true" :model="queryForm" clas...
Vue.js 实现前端页面 & 通过 axios 库请求后台接口获取数据后重新渲染页面; Flask & Flask-CORS 提供接口 & 实现跨域服务。 打包Vue.js 文件 & 部署到服务器,通过 index 页面进行访问。 如果需要最终可以在公网访问最终打包好的 Vue 前端界面,则执行以下操作: 在服务器实现文件 get_msg.py 文件中配置 app.run...
Python vue前后端登录分离 flask vue前后端分离 0.需求 需要将深度学习算法Demo做成可以用来展示的网页应用 1.技术栈 前端: 框架:Vue UI库:Bootstrap 后端: 开发语言:Python REST API: flask 2.前端 2.1环境搭建 因为选择使用Vue来作为开发的框架,我们需要安装Node.js...
使用vue-cli命令生成项目,命令格式为:vue init webpack Vue-Project, 这里为vue init webpack epimetheus-frontend, 首先找个存在代码的文件夹,这里先创建一个epimetheus文件夹 进入epimetheus文件夹 执行vue init webpack epimetheus-frontend 根据提示填写项目信息: ...
124引入强大的modelserializer,Python+Django+Vue前后端分离全栈课程,带小白学前后端分离 7274 4 23:11 App 基于Python+Django+Ansible的运维管理系统 61 0 04:47 App 41random模块,Python+Django+Vue前后端分离全栈课程,带小白学前后端分离 312 0 03:10 App 49.介绍Django框架 1391 1 20:49 App 基于Python...
4. 整合前后端分离登陆功能 最后,我们需要将Flask后端和Vue前端整合在一起,实现完整的前后端分离登陆功能。以下是一个简单的整合代码示例: gantt title 前后端分离登陆甘特图 section 登陆验证 Flask后端开发 :done, 01-01, 3d Vue前端开发 :done, after Flask后端开发, 2d ...
一、使用Vue-cli搭建前端框架 1、安装vue-cli 如果之前安装过了vue,可以输入vue --version 来查看当前的vue版本是否是3.x以上的版本,如果返回的版本是旧版本 (1.x 或 2.x),你需要先通过 npm uninstall vue-cli -g 卸载它。 查看vue-cli版本的命令行 ...